Decoherence-Resistant Quantum Neural Networks

Quantum neural networks (QNNs) hold immense potential for revolutionizing machine learning by leveraging the principles of superposition and entanglement. Yet, these delicate quantum systems are highly susceptible to decoherence, a process that destroys their quantum states through interaction with the environment. To realize the full power of QNNs, it is crucial to develop methods that mitigate decoherence effects. Researchers are actively exploring various strategies, including fault-tolerant quantum computation and dynamical decoupling, to construct decoherence-resistant QNN architectures.
